Abstract:
 Demonstration of stapedectomy surgery in a 42 year old woman who had a tympanoplasty six months previously.  The surgeon used a technique of placement of and crimping of the prosthesis before disarticulating and removing the stapes.  This has the advantage of helping to prevent subluxation of the Incus and a floating footplate.  Perforating the footplate before removing the stape's suprastructure also allows testing for and easier control of a perilymphatic gusher.   Post-operatively she had a 20 dB closure of her air-bone gap.
